Lithium Ionic Announces Definitive Feasibility Study Results for Bandeira Lithium Project, Minas Gerais, Brazil

Core Insights - The updated Feasibility Study for the Bandeira Lithium Project demonstrates a longer mine life, lower capital costs, and stronger project economics, positioning it as one of the lowest-cost hard rock spodumene projects globally [1][10][35] Project Economics - Post-tax NPV at 8% is improved to US$1.45 billion from US$1.31 billion in the previous study, with a post-tax IRR increasing to 61% from 40% [6][32] - The payback period has been reduced to 2.2 years from 3.4 years, indicating a quicker return on investment [6][32] - Average annual gross revenue over the life of the mine is projected at US$343 million, down from US$417 million in the prior study [6][32] Capital and Operating Costs - Initial capital expenditures (CAPEX) have been reduced by approximately 28% to US$191 million from US$266 million [6][27] - Site operating costs are estimated at US$378 per tonne of spodumene concentrate produced, which is competitive within the global lithium industry [6][29] Mine Life and Production - The mine life has been extended to 18.5 years from 14 years, supported by a 6 million tonne increase in proven and probable reserves [6][11] - Total life-of-mine production is projected at 23.2 million tonnes, with an average annual production rate of 177,000 tonnes of spodumene concentrate [6][38] Environmental and Operational Design - The project incorporates responsible environmental design, including a long-term underground mining strategy to minimize land disturbance and water consumption [9][10] - The processing plant design utilizes proven technology and modular components to reduce costs and enhance operational efficiency [9][23] Infrastructure and Location - The Bandeira property is located in Brazil's Lithium Valley, an area known for its high-quality spodumene concentrate production [1][14] - The project benefits from excellent local infrastructure, including proximity to major highways and a key logistical port for exporting lithium concentrate [15][16] Regulatory and Permitting Status - The project is advancing through the permitting process, with a positive technical endorsement received from the Minas Gerais State Secretariat for the Environment [42][43] - Ongoing engagement with regulatory agencies and community stakeholders is aimed at ensuring compliance and addressing evolving expectations [43][44]
